From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from smtp3.osuosl.org (smtp3.osuosl.org [140.211.166.136]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id A0D97C83F22 for ; Wed, 16 Jul 2025 20:39:14 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by smtp3.osuosl.org (Postfix) with ESMTP id 50F7561506; Wed, 16 Jul 2025 20:39:14 +0000 (UTC) X-Virus-Scanned: amavis at osuosl.org Received: from smtp3.osuosl.org ([127.0.0.1]) by localhost (smtp3.osuosl.org [127.0.0.1]) (amavis, port 10024) with ESMTP id MAXmk7wWHUSi; Wed, 16 Jul 2025 20:39:13 +0000 (UTC) X-Comment: SPF check N/A for local connections - client-ip=140.211.166.142; helo=lists1.osuosl.org; envelope-from=buildroot-bounces@buildroot.org; receiver= DKIM-Filter: OpenDKIM Filter v2.11.0 smtp3.osuosl.org 7173960DBF Received: from lists1.osuosl.org (lists1.osuosl.org [140.211.166.142]) by smtp3.osuosl.org (Postfix) with ESMTP id 7173960DBF; Wed, 16 Jul 2025 20:39:13 +0000 (UTC) Received: from smtp1.osuosl.org (smtp1.osuosl.org [IPv6:2605:bc80:3010::138]) by lists1.osuosl.org (Postfix) with ESMTP id 111DD234 for ; Wed, 16 Jul 2025 20:39:12 +0000 (UTC) Received: from localhost (localhost [127.0.0.1]) by smtp1.osuosl.org (Postfix) with ESMTP id 0221683E85 for ; Wed, 16 Jul 2025 20:39:12 +0000 (UTC) X-Virus-Scanned: amavis at osuosl.org Received: from smtp1.osuosl.org ([127.0.0.1]) by localhost (smtp1.osuosl.org [127.0.0.1]) (amavis, port 10024) with ESMTP id b3VvNU8tvF0j for ; Wed, 16 Jul 2025 20:39:11 +0000 (UTC) Received-SPF: Pass (mailfrom) identity=mailfrom; client-ip=2a00:1450:4864:20::435; helo=mail-wr1-x435.google.com; envelope-from=petr.vorel@gmail.com; receiver= DMARC-Filter: OpenDMARC Filter v1.4.2 smtp1.osuosl.org 0D77C83CC0 DKIM-Filter: OpenDKIM Filter v2.11.0 smtp1.osuosl.org 0D77C83CC0 Received: from mail-wr1-x435.google.com (mail-wr1-x435.google.com [IPv6:2a00:1450:4864:20::435]) by smtp1.osuosl.org (Postfix) with ESMTPS id 0D77C83CC0 for ; Wed, 16 Jul 2025 20:39:10 +0000 (UTC) Received: by mail-wr1-x435.google.com with SMTP id ffacd0b85a97d-3a4f379662cso188771f8f.0 for ; Wed, 16 Jul 2025 13:39:10 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1752698349; x=1753303149; h=in-reply-to:content-disposition:mime-version:references:reply-to :message-id:subject:cc:to:from:date: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=i/uVCsSoPZF28b2mArxHNTV3akeJ4kYUbB1khdhF7EI=; b=azfSOKbUZjTOCYXLvqE+Sp+30yLYfhrY4la6mXGlXsG9vgMLm0hz6NFbTBePEMEYjF ilmob/ACkG0GBESbynO9uJvQX+tSkirjnjPADSY97ry+Q60NI/BQM+ftygmhfC70lo// vZzinjOdW5HjITkKuiGMPodqrRSa6F43GzvtuZgZVFeartYZt1XvEvijPmZvfVl3lHlT imsF9Vvoh7K5eYF9GN4M/2Mm8EItyClMJJNoc0wJdM+6XXkVydwrr3yjBF4OZAA62BZr ALh5ztgw6wKBhuwj//L5LWZOlkUdN6/2CLh56aezzVAwqo86SdFUqfVbmx04yHu8yNkM 1mAg== X-Gm-Message-State: AOJu0YxBhUU+MosF4mF+/qO/6UOqWzPbWeDEG5pNv0gsz9tCZbIuCxX2 996BtviiMnO4Qj0TUzVJiE+xxpfj6R/QIbNtPDhqKMXn3Vq/Yf8TMRK9BrWjZQ== X-Gm-Gg: ASbGncvpz3r5LvyWcwVrgID5/i5Yo4GlqM1TZZ2C0X+QTW+wSqQXV6jUfQ8zJugP1jz u3d2z79Bcp56SmoTci94VQk5o1ZkD0j4OaI9Os+vefEt24QibBpfmWupoZLamsKSVtKoRi+tNwP 7/K7V8YPjDq5KL4mgHbiq7fe/3uOmsKQWanKs3h5B+XbGXeYL2d/9xeLc9vUc6HC9jWypKOHcwU UW2Gqt3Mekr2xLbbfUiQwId5Hy5Yk7Zwc6ar885e1zxko3MPXQUmcCT/mViYWiFlxx7g2XL97gl 4iLDvvrC8XAki4vaHh+jsRJc98PiY39pn3qOYP803UVwxjOwWOY6RWw4h81sBfNeJ3h99g2/Wy6 VAH6epFxBeBuFekSXfoIRnyj3w0g= X-Google-Smtp-Source: AGHT+IEyn9ChmeREkD9pk7RacQCtpJDXyPXdpPdEV1GuCvEc1pVpBZAkdUGnLh0Dr4QxIAwqUZmOpA== X-Received: by 2002:a05:6000:43c6:10b0:3a4:f744:e01b with SMTP id ffacd0b85a97d-3b60e50fde7mr2615293f8f.39.1752698348715; Wed, 16 Jul 2025 13:39:08 -0700 (PDT) Received: from pevik (gw1.ms-free.net. [185.243.124.10]) by smtp.gmail.com with ESMTPSA id ffacd0b85a97d-3b5e8e1e1a5sm18473548f8f.74.2025.07.16.13.39.07 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 16 Jul 2025 13:39:08 -0700 (PDT) Date: Wed, 16 Jul 2025 22:39:06 +0200 From: Petr Vorel To: Edgar Bonet Cc: Buildroot development , Julien Olivain , "Yann E. MORIN" Message-ID: <20250716203906.GA9246@pevik> References: <8c5d92c3-172b-405e-8711-1b561c7ae7b1@grenoble.cnrs.fr> MIME-Version: 1.0 Content-Disposition: inline In-Reply-To: <8c5d92c3-172b-405e-8711-1b561c7ae7b1@grenoble.cnrs.fr> X-Mailman-Original-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1752698349; x=1753303149; darn=buildroot.org; h=in-reply-to:content-disposition:mime-version:references:reply-to :message-id:subject:cc:to:from:date:from:to:cc:subject:date :message-id:reply-to; bh=i/uVCsSoPZF28b2mArxHNTV3akeJ4kYUbB1khdhF7EI=; b=D+gNqtv6gFZsF3yhpyzU33PwBKsPitsAZlVqgkqx1MdSQb8whmFDCG97AdNFkeZp3k sIHbvFuYqyGbzxMxig433zz4v7mknejf4BdSWpfmvO84bItW6SUq0LloMgXrYE3n2YcE wk6pNYuu4iNhsODk9qD5ErHLgAEZRE3Hw9zx/GW7f0xZfb++8rxX75Fjayy0ySL6AOue SPLGRQx6Bvc8MPiQrRvWLJJ39Z5wNkv6O0EqbDTW2BIVexOIXwm4dhrC5Vk4A/SPY8th wh82lN3VdRWerPpCzTwk9xynaf0eEOXpO6tgOn0UsQo6DM4AOEkUFHEp+hPoXZCjxtCj x8wQ== X-Mailman-Original-Authentication-Results: smtp1.osuosl.org; dmarc=pass (p=none dis=none) header.from=gmail.com X-Mailman-Original-Authentication-Results: smtp1.osuosl.org; dkim=pass (2048-bit key, unprotected) header.d=gmail.com header.i=@gmail.com header.a=rsa-sha256 header.s=20230601 header.b=D+gNqtv6 Subject: Re: [Buildroot] [PATCH v2 1/4] support/kconfig/patches: make all patches quilt-friendly X-BeenThere: buildroot@buildroot.org X-Mailman-Version: 2.1.30 Precedence: list List-Id: Discussion and development of buildroot List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: Petr Vorel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: buildroot-bounces@buildroot.org Sender: "buildroot" Hi Edgar, > According to support/kconfig/README.buildroot, the patches in > support/kconfig/patches/ are meant to be applied by quilt. However, two > of those patches are in git format, which makes quilt error out with: > Applying patch patches/22-kconfig-lxdialog-fix-check-with-GCC14.patch > can't find file to patch at input line 32 > [...] > No file to patch. Skipping patch. > Fix the format to make quilt happy. How about using 'git quiltimport' instead? Kind regards, Petr > Signed-off-by: Edgar Bonet > --- > ...config-lxdialog-fix-check-with-GCC14.patch | 11 +++---- > ...onfig-mn-conf-handle-backspace-H-key.patch | 31 +++++++++---------- > 2 files changed, 18 insertions(+), 24 deletions(-) > diff --git a/support/kconfig/patches/22-kconfig-lxdialog-fix-check-with-GCC14.patch b/support/kconfig/patches/22-kconfig-lxdialog-fix-check-with-GCC14.patch > index 41081bb45d..edcc857190 100644 > --- a/support/kconfig/patches/22-kconfig-lxdialog-fix-check-with-GCC14.patch > +++ b/support/kconfig/patches/22-kconfig-lxdialog-fix-check-with-GCC14.patch > @@ -25,10 +25,10 @@ Tested-by: Petr Vorel > kconfig/lxdialog/check-lxdialog.sh | 2 +- > 1 file changed, 1 insertion(+), 1 deletion(-) > -diff --git a/kconfig/lxdialog/check-lxdialog.sh b/kconfig/lxdialog/check-lxdialog.sh > -index 16cd9a3186..27d6c30a57 100755 > ---- a/kconfig/lxdialog/check-lxdialog.sh > -+++ b/kconfig/lxdialog/check-lxdialog.sh > +Index: kconfig.new/lxdialog/check-lxdialog.sh > +=================================================================== > +--- kconfig.orig/lxdialog/check-lxdialog.sh > ++++ kconfig/lxdialog/check-lxdialog.sh > @@ -48,7 +48,7 @@ trap "rm -f $tmp" 0 1 2 3 15 > check() { > $cc -x c - -o $tmp 2>/dev/null <<'EOF' > @@ -38,6 +38,3 @@ index 16cd9a3186..27d6c30a57 100755 > EOF > if [ $? != 0 ]; then > echo " *** Unable to find the ncurses libraries or the" 1>&2 > --- > -2.44.0 > - > diff --git a/support/kconfig/patches/23-kconfig-mn-conf-handle-backspace-H-key.patch b/support/kconfig/patches/23-kconfig-mn-conf-handle-backspace-H-key.patch > index 6e32115f70..f72f9f339b 100644 > --- a/support/kconfig/patches/23-kconfig-mn-conf-handle-backspace-H-key.patch > +++ b/support/kconfig/patches/23-kconfig-mn-conf-handle-backspace-H-key.patch > @@ -16,11 +16,11 @@ Signed-off-by: Masahiro Yamada > kconfig/nconf.gui.c | 3 ++- > 3 files changed, 5 insertions(+), 3 deletions(-) > -diff --git a/kconfig/lxdialog/inputbox.c b/kconfig/lxdialog/inputbox.c > -index 611945611bf8..1dcfb288ee63 100644 > ---- a/kconfig/lxdialog/inputbox.c > -+++ b/kconfig/lxdialog/inputbox.c > -@@ -113,7 +113,8 @@ int dialog_inputbox(const char *title, const char *prompt, int height, int width > +Index: kconfig/lxdialog/inputbox.c > +=================================================================== > +--- kconfig.orig/lxdialog/inputbox.c > ++++ kconfig/lxdialog/inputbox.c > +@@ -126,7 +126,8 @@ int dialog_inputbox(const char *title, const char *prompt, int height, int width > case KEY_DOWN: > break; > case KEY_BACKSPACE: > @@ -30,10 +30,10 @@ index 611945611bf8..1dcfb288ee63 100644 > if (pos) { > wattrset(dialog, dlg.inputbox.atr); > if (input_x == 0) { > -diff --git a/kconfig/nconf.c b/kconfig/nconf.c > -index a4670f4e825a..ac92c0ded6c5 100644 > ---- a/kconfig/nconf.c > -+++ b/kconfig/nconf.c > +Index: kconfig/nconf.c > +=================================================================== > +--- kconfig.orig/nconf.c > ++++ kconfig/nconf.c > @@ -1048,7 +1048,7 @@ static int do_match(int key, struct match_state *state, int *ans) > state->match_direction = FIND_NEXT_MATCH_UP; > *ans = get_mext_match(state->pattern, > @@ -43,11 +43,11 @@ index a4670f4e825a..ac92c0ded6c5 100644 > state->pattern[strlen(state->pattern)-1] = '\0'; > adj_match_dir(&state->match_direction); > } else > -diff --git a/kconfig/nconf.gui.c b/kconfig/nconf.gui.c > -index 7be620a1fcdb..77f525a8617c 100644 > ---- a/kconfig/nconf.gui.c > -+++ b/kconfig/nconf.gui.c > -@@ -439,7 +439,8 @@ int dialog_inputbox(WINDOW *main_window, > +Index: kconfig/nconf.gui.c > +=================================================================== > +--- kconfig.orig/nconf.gui.c > ++++ kconfig/nconf.gui.c > +@@ -440,7 +440,8 @@ int dialog_inputbox(WINDOW *main_window, > case KEY_F(F_EXIT): > case KEY_F(F_BACK): > break; > @@ -57,6 +57,3 @@ index 7be620a1fcdb..77f525a8617c 100644 > case KEY_BACKSPACE: > if (cursor_position > 0) { > memmove(&result[cursor_position-1], > --- > -2.48.1 > - _______________________________________________ buildroot mailing list buildroot@buildroot.org https://lists.buildroot.org/mailman/listinfo/buildroot